โœฆ Synopsis


In this paper dielectric phenomena with two relaxation times are discussed. By assuming a sinusoidal form for induction vector D a sinusoidal electric field is generated and it depends on unknown phenomenological coefficients whose expressions together to their numerical values as functions of frequency are obtained. Moreover, electromagnetic wave propagation is analysed obtaining wave vector as function of the aforementioned coefficients. The results are applied to a Vinylidene Chloride-Vinyl Chloride (VDC-VC) to test the applicability of the model.
